Valuations and Ownership in Sports
This chapter explores the emotional and financial implications of sports team valuations, focusing on various franchises and the market trends influencing them. The discussion addresses the motivations behind wealthy individuals acquiring teams, the rising costs for fans, and the significant impact of global media rights on team valuations. It also examines the complexities of professional tennis economics, including gender equity, player compensation disparities, and the influence of top players on the sport's financial landscape.
